摘 要:针对粉土地层水泥搅拌桩止水帷幕施工过程中水泥土早期强度低、成桩质量差、易出现渗漏等问题,以工业副产品磷石膏和水泥为固化剂稳固粉土,通过无侧限抗压强度试验、柔性壁渗透试验、X射线衍射测试(XRD)和电镜扫描试验(SEM),研究了粉土固化土的力学性能、渗透性状以及固化机理。结果表明适量的磷石膏可加快固化土初期钙矾石(AFt)的生成,对止水帷幕的早期强度具有促进作用;AFt的膨胀性对水泥土的强度和渗透性状具有双重影响,AFt生成量较少时,可有效填充土体孔隙,提高水泥土强度和抗渗性能,AFt生成量较大时,因其体积膨胀会导致已生成的胶结体被破坏,从而引起改良土强度和抗渗性能降低。通过试验研究,建议在南京长江漫滩基坑止水帷幕施工中:水泥掺量为20%左右,磷石膏掺量为水泥掺量的10%左右,以实现基坑止水帷幕效果改良和废弃磷石膏的资源化利用。Tosolvethe problems of low cement-soil early strength,poor pile quality and appearance of leakage during the construction of cement mixing pile in silt layer,the industrial by-products phosphogypsum and cement are used as curing agent to stabilize silt,and the unconfined compressive strength test,flexible-wall permeameter tests,X-ray diffraction(XRD)and scanning electron microscopetest(SEM)are taken to investigate the mechanical properties,permeability properties and curing mechanism of solidified silt.The results show that proper amount of phosphogypsum can accelerate the formation of ettringite(Aft)at the early reaction stage and promote the early strength of the waterproof structure.The expansibility of ettringite has a dual influence on the strength and permeability of cement-soil.When the amount of AFt is small,it can fill the soil pores and improve the strength and permeability of cement-soil.When the amount of ettringite is large,AFt′sexpanding destroys the existing cementation and reduces the strength and permeability of solidified soil.Therefore,it is suggested that the cement content should be about 20% and the phosphogypsum content should be about 10% of the cement content in the construction of the waterproof structure of the Yangtze River floodplain in Nanjing,so as to realize the improvement of the waterproof structure and the resource utilization of wasted phosphogypsum.
